Spider Veins vs Varicose Veins: How They Differ

Superficial vascular abnormalities are commonly called either spider veins or varicose veins, but they are not the same. Spider veins are small, threadlike vessels visible just beneath the surface of the skin, often red or purple and arranged in a web-like pattern. They are usually cosmetic and seldom produce symptoms. By contrast, varicose veins are larger, swollen, twisting veins that bulge and can be felt under the skin. Varicose veins can cause aching, heaviness, cramping, swelling, and — in more severe cases — skin changes or ulcers.

Understanding these differences helps determine whether treatment is elective for appearance or medically advised to address pain and prevent complications.

Medical Treatment Options

A range of modern procedures can reduce or eliminate problematic veins. The best choice depends on vein size, symptoms, anatomy, and overall health.

  • Sclerotherapy: A chemical solution is injected into smaller affected veins, causing the vein walls to stick together and the vessel to fade over weeks. It is commonly used for spider veins and smaller varicosities.

  • Laser treatment: Concentrated light energy is applied to close off small superficial veins. External lasers are often used for spider veins and tiny surface vessels.

  • Radiofrequency ablation (RFA): This minimally invasive method uses heat from radiofrequency energy delivered inside the vein to seal it shut. It is effective for larger saphenous varicose veins.

  • Endovenous laser treatment (EVLT): Similar to RFA, EVLT employs laser energy delivered by a fiber inside the vein to collapse it. It is a common outpatient option for sizable refluxing veins.

  • Vein stripping and surgical removal: Reserved for severe cases or when other techniques aren’t suitable. This is a more invasive approach that physically removes a damaged vein.

Each technique has advantages and trade-offs. Minimally invasive options like sclerotherapy, EVLT, and RFA typically offer faster recovery and fewer complications than traditional surgery.

What to Expect During Treatment and Recovery

Most contemporary varicose vein procedures are performed on an outpatient basis using local anesthesia and sometimes light sedation. Recovery tends to be swift:

  • Immediately after treatment, compression stockings are usually applied to reduce swelling and promote healing.
  • Patients are encouraged to stay lightly active and walk frequently to improve circulation; prolonged bed rest is not recommended.
  • Many people resume routine activities in 24 to 48 hours, though higher-impact exercise may be postponed for several days to weeks depending on the procedure.
  • Some bruising, tenderness, and mild swelling are common and typically subside within days to a few weeks.

Your provider will give specific guidance on activity limits, wound care, and follow-up scans or appointments.

Costs and Comparing Providers

When evaluating treatment options, consider both clinical experience and financial factors. Insurance may cover treatment when varicose veins cause symptoms or complications, but cosmetic treatment is often out-of-pocket. Typical price ranges vary by procedure, geographic area, and provider.


Treatment Type Average Cost Range Insurance Coverage
Sclerotherapy $200–$800 per session Sometimes covered
Laser Treatment $600–$3,000 Often covered if medically necessary
EVLT $2,500–$5,000 Usually covered with symptoms
Vein Stripping $1,500–$3,000 Typically covered when required

When comparing providers, look for board certification, experience with the specific procedure you need, before-and-after photos, patient reviews, and clear explanations of risks and expected outcomes. Ask about pre-procedure testing, anesthesia options, and follow-up care.

Preventing New Varicose Veins and Long-term Leg Care

Even after successful treatment, new veins can develop. Lifestyle measures can reduce recurrence and support overall venous health:

  • Exercise regularly with emphasis on walking and calf-strengthening activities to improve circulation.
  • Maintain a healthy weight to reduce pressure on leg veins.
  • Avoid prolonged standing or sitting; take regular breaks to move and elevate legs when possible.
  • Wear compression stockings as recommended by your clinician, especially during long travel or periods of prolonged standing.
  • Raise your legs periodically throughout the day to aid venous return.

Routine monitoring and early treatment of new symptomatic veins can prevent progression and complications.
